Planejamento digital e plástica oclusal na reabilitação oral: relato de caso

Reabilitações orais extensas frequentemente requerem a modificação da Dimensão Vertical de Oclusão (DVO) para restabelecer função, estética e estabilidade oclusal, especialmente em pacientes com desgaste dentário e guias de desoclusão inadequadas. Este relato apresenta uma reabilitação oral total adesiva com aumento planejado da DVO, por meio de abordagem minimamente invasiva baseada em planejamento digital e materiais resinosos, denominada Plástica Oclusal. Paciente masculino, 52 anos, apresentava queixa estética e fraturas recorrentes nos dentes anteriores, associadas à ausência de guias oclusais e contatos excessivos anteriores. O planejamento incluiu registro da relação cêntrica com JIG, escaneamento intraoral, montagem em articulador digital e enceramento diagnóstico em software de código aberto (Autodesk Meshmixer®). O aumento da DVO foi estabelecido em 1,7 mm na região posterior, possibilitando a reanatomização anterior e restabelecimento das guias de desoclusão. Após fase provisória com restaurações impressas em 3D para validação funcional e estética, realizou-se a reabilitação definitiva com facetas diretas em resina composta e overlays table-top fresados por CAD/CAM. Observou-se estabilidade oclusal, conforto muscular, melhora estética e satisfação do paciente, evidenciando abordagem previsível e conservadora.
